## Tuning the Fennick Breaker

The Fennick breaker guards calls to the upstream Ledgerline API. When error rates cross the trip threshold, it opens, fails fast, and probes periodically before closing again. Support team: most "API down" tickets are actually the breaker doing its job, so check breaker state before escalating. If a customer insists on different behavior, file a config change rather than editing values by hand. The stock settings we ship are listed below.

constants for bawif-kawif:
QUOTAS = {
    "ulaael": 5,
    "holael": 10,
}

Onboarding: Payroll Export Change (Quillhaven)

As of cycle 14, Quillhaven exports payroll as pipe-delimited files, not fixed-width. Old parsers break silently — verify column counts before loading. The converter lives in the Tallow repo; run it per pay group. Exported archives are encrypted at rest. To decrypt a historical export during training, enter the recovery passphrase shown on the line below.

vault phrase of bafop-bagep = holael-quenwyn

# Break-Glass: Quillbase Autocomplete Index

Plugin authors — if the autocomplete index gets slow (p95 over 800ms), don't hammer retries; you'll make it worse. Break-glass lets you bypass the index and hit the raw term store directly. It's rate-limited, so use it sparingly and file a ticket after. Access requires unsealing the bypass credential store, which opens with the recovery passphrase below.

unlock words, yawig-kagef: gordor-holvan-ulaael-pramir-ulaiel-tamdor